Title :
Bayesian network based post processing of phonetic primitives in handwritten Pitman´s Shorthand

Abstract :
An innovative solution to the lexical post processing of handwritten Pitman´s shorthand, denoted as the Bayesian Network (BN) based transcription is discussed along with experimental results. Unlike the conventional phonetic based transliteration approach, the paper presents a novel primitive based transcription method along with the creation of a new machine readable Pitman´s shorthand lexicon. The Bayesian Network representation is shown to be robust against stroke variation and highly effective for handling major ambiguities of handwritten Pitman´s Shorthand, including unpredictable vowel omissions and unclear thicknesses between similar consonant strokes. Pitman´s shorthand specific unigram-based rejection strategies are also introduced that are highly effective in finding the most likely candidate words for a given outline.
